1

The Art and Heritage of Taxidermy

News Discuss 
Taxidermy, the artwork of preserving and mounting animals, dates back again many hundreds of years and it has advanced appreciably over time. This practice blends science and artwork, aiming to seize the lifetime-like essence of animals principally for academic, scientific, or decor needs. The phrase "taxidermy" originates through the Greek https://taxidermyhub.com/product-tag/taxidermy-mounts-for-sale/

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story